The Core Difference: Mixing Process and Application

Plant mixed surfacing refers to bituminous mixtures produced in a controlled mixing plant, where temperature, gradation, and binder content are precisely regulated. It is typically applied in thinner layers, ideal for overlays, maintenance, or low-volume roads.

On the other hand, asphalt concrete is a broader term encompassing dense, medium, and open-graded mixtures—designed for structural performance. It is often used in base and binder courses on highways and airports.

Key distinctions include:

  • Material composition: Plant mixed surfacing focuses on surface texture and wear resistance; asphalt concrete emphasizes load distribution.
  • Layer thickness: Plant-mixed layers are usually thinner and applied over existing surfaces.
  • Binder variation: Modified or performance-grade binders are often used in asphalt concrete.
  • Longevity and cost: Asphalt concrete typically offers higher long-term strength but at a greater initial cost.
